Making Dedication (formerly known as Personal) is a formerly unidentified post-punk song by Oregon based band First Person, released in 1989. The song is often compared to Joy Division.
Search History[]
The song was first posted to Facebook by Robi Knepp, stating that he recorded it off the radio station 105.1 FM (KXYQ), in late 1989 or early 1990. The song was aired during the new music hour, a show aired on Sunday's at midnight on KXYQ, and was hosted by a female DJ.
A band that was often suggested was Nero's Rome, and when James Angell was asked about the song, he simply replied with a thumbs up, but with no other info. However, when another band member was asked, they confirmed that it was not Nero's Rome, and they had never heard the song before.
Another often suggested band was Wild Swans, but the singer of the band, Paul Simpson, confirmed that it wasn't from them. The song was reposted by the Slicing Up Eyeballs Facebook page, but this provided no new leads.
Identification[]
On November 15th, 2021, the song was identified as Making Dedication by First Person. The song along with an accompanying performance video had been uploaded to YouTube just one week prior by Jordan Rzad, bass player for First Person.
Discord user MarkTrail had contacted SP Clarke, a music historian from Portland, who sent the song to several people. One of these people was First Person's guitarist Stu Carpenter who instantly recognized the song. He commented on the original Facebook post linking the upload, where it was discovered by u/sinkingshipsfan on reddit who posted a thread in R/Lostwave announcing the song had been solved.
First Person band members reunited and drummer Collin Colebank found the master tapes including a Digital Audio Tape containing a higher quality recording of Making Dedication. After a few weeks the song along with other previously unreleased First Person songs were uploaded to Spotify and other streaming services. On March 3rd, 2022, the song hit 1000 streams on Spotify.

First Person[]
First Person was a short-lived post-punk band from Portland, Oregon, USA.
The band consisted of Mark Johnson, Collin Colebank, Stu Carpenter and Jordan Rzad.
They have four songs to their name: Making Dedication, Someday, My Mistake and An Afterschool Special.
